Description azmoon22 2019-09-14 10:28:41 UTC
SUMMARY
Once, on my locked laptop, I typed in my password, and to my shock, when I pressed Enter to login, my password turned visible!

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
Unknown! It has only happened once since I have had my Kubuntu 18.
And I have not ever encountered such a problem in 5 years, neither in Kubuntu14 nor 16.

OBSERVED RESULT
visible user password at login

EXPECTED RESULT
normal password input (shown as bullets/circles)

Comment 1 Nate Graham 2020-06-03 14:14:34 UTC
I'm almost certain that what was happening was that the "show password" button had gotten focus such that hitting the return/enter key both clicked the button and also sent the password.

The button has been removed in Plasma 5.19, so this is no longer possible.
